Houston hit by “catastrophic” flooding

By Duncan Mil

August 28, 2017 - Houston, the capital of the U.S. oil and gas industry and the country’s fourth biggest city, continues to be hit by “catastrophic” flooding as the remnants of now-Tropical Storm Harvey have all but parked over south Texas.

The storm is inundating the region around Houston with “unprecedented” rain, according to the National Weather Service, with more than 500mm of rain expected by Friday.

The Insurance Information Institute said flood damage could match the $15 billion in flood insurance losses caused by Hurricane Katrina in 2005, Reuters reported.
